Ingredients:  
Ingredients:  
1 # hamburger cooked and drained
1 can enchilada sauce
½ head iceberg lettuce torn or shredded
1 onion chopped
1 large bag of Fritos
1 large cans chili beans
1 bunch of celery sliced
1 medium tomato sliced
¾ # cheddar cheese

Directions:
Directions:
Layer all ending with cheese and Fritos s in a stew pot bake at 350 for 20 minutes the lettuce will get soggy so don’t plan to serve as leftover best made for a large group and eaten first time.

Personal Notes:
Personal Notes:
This recipe was used by the Denver Fire Dept and was a favorite of my Step father who was a
Fireman in Denver for 20 years.
